Edward-Elmhurst Immediate Care - Oswego is a state-of-the-art health institution located at 6701 U.S. 34 in Oswego, Illinois, United States. Our facility provides immediate medical care for a variety of non-life-threatening illnesses and injuries. Our highly trained and experienced medical staff is dedicated to providing top-quality care in a timely manner. Whether you need treatment for a minor injury, illness, or preventive care services, Edward-Elmhurst Immediate Care - Oswego is here to help.
